Delphi 7에서 액세스 위반을 최종적으로 수정하는 방법은 무엇입니까?

컴퓨터 성능이 걱정되십니까? 긴장을 풀고 Reimage이 모든 것을 처리하도록 하십시오.

이 사용자 가이드의 내용은 “비-Delphi 강력한 주소에서 액세스 위반” 오류 메시지가 표시될 때 도움을 주기 위한 것입니다.이것은 누군가의 코드가 누군가가 그것을 할 수 있도록 메모리의 금지된 부분에 액세스하고 있음을 의미합니다. 이것은 일반적으로 최악의 메모리를 가리키는 객체 참조에 다른 포인터가 있다는 것입니다. 정보 기술이 아직 초기화되거나 출시되지 않았다고 생각하기 때문일 수도 있습니다. 델파이와 같은 디버거를 사용하십시오.

9

Delphi에서 오류 코드 00405772는 무엇입니까?

“모듈 Project1.exe에 대한 주소 00405772일 때 액세스 위반입니다. 읽기는 00000388과 연결되어 있습니다.” 따라서 문제는 문자 그대로 “Project1.exe” 모듈에 있는 00405772에 AV가 있는 것으로 끝납니다. Delphi 디버거는 매우 정확한 코드 줄로 안내합니다(또는 Find Error 적용). 주소 00000388의 메모리를 확인하려고 합니다.

OOP를 시작하는 데 도움을 주기 위해 델파이에 대해 확신이 있습니다. 그러나 Access Violation 메시지가 나타납니다.Pushing public property into a other private field.

주소의 액세스 위반이란 무엇입니까?

주소 위반 오류는 Windows 이외의 모든 버전에 나타날 수 있으며 Windows 10이 실행됩니다. 이 메시지가 표시되면 가장 확실히 실행하려고 하는 소프트웨어가 보호된 메모리 주소에 액세스하려고 시도하는 것입니다. 인터넷상의 PC 사용자가 특정 프로그램을 사용하지 못하도록 차단하는 절대 팝업처럼 보입니다.

<예비><코드> 연산자 클래스; 의미 TData = 클래스 사적인 CurrUser: 사용자; 연결: TFDConnection; 쿼리: TFDQuery; 프로시저 SetUser(newUser: 사용자); 프로시저 SetConnection(newConn:TFDConnection); 프로시저 SetQuery(newQry:TFDQuery);일반적인 CUser 속성: 자세히 읽기 사용자 CurrUser 쓰기 SetUser; Conn 속성: TFDConnection 읽기, SetConnection 연결 생성, 속성 쿼리: TFDQuery 검사 쿼리, SetQuery 작성, 클래스 처리 항목(uID: 정수); 공전; 의료 작업 클래스 종료(uID: 정수); 공전; 종료 앱(); 범주 치료; 공전;끝;성능$R *.fmx절차 TData.SetUser(newUser: 사용자);시작하다 := 커서 newUser;끝;절차 TData.TFDConnection);시작하다 setconnection(newconn: 연결 := newConn;끝;절차 TData.SetQuery(newQry:TFDQuery);시작하다 요청:= newRequest;끝;
access encroachment at address no delphi 7

II는 이 속성을 구현하는 연결을 정의할 수 있지만 이 작업은 속성을 작성하는 모든 소프트웨어 패키지에서 탐색 시작 위반이 사용된다고 말할 때 제공합니다. :TData.Conn.LoginPrompt: 거짓;TData.Conn.Cconnected : true와 동일,

Delphi에서 단일 액세스 위반을 수정하려면 어떻게 해야 하나요?

“액세스 위반”은 종종 제공되지 않은 훌륭한 개체에 대한 참조로 인해 발생해야 합니다. 디버거 도구/옵션을 사용하여 Language Exceptions 탭에서 “Break Delphi Exceptions”를 쉽게 만들 수 있습니다. 그런 다음 “앞으로 가기 위한 단계 또는 제어”가 작동합니다.

var TData: frmData.TData;  로그인 양식: TLoginForm; ErrorCount: 정수;성능$R *.fmx절차 TLoginForm.ExitAppButtonClick(발신자: TObject);시작하다  TData.ExitApp;끝;절차 TLoginForm.LoginButtonClick(발신자: TObject);바르 CompanyPath 및 문자열  간호사: 정수;시작하다  (UsernameInput.Text가 '') 또는 (PasswordInput.Text가 실제로 '') 또는 (PincodeInput.Text = '')인 경우  시작할 때    ShowMessage('자격증을 입력하세요.');    로그 오프하다;  끝; 시도하다     TData.Conn : TFDConnection.Create(nil)와 같음;    TData.Conn.Params.DriverID 'MSAcc'; := TData.Conn.Params.Database := 'D:PulseDBAlfaPersonnelPulse.mdb';    TData.Conn.LoginPrompt := 거짓;    TData.Conn. := 연결됨 True;    if(TData.Conn.Connected <> True) 그러면    시작하다      ShowMessage('게시할 수 없습니다, 다시 시도하십시오');      로그 오프하다;    끝    뿐만 아니라 //연결된 경우    그들이 시작할 수 있도록      TData.Qry := TFDQuery.Create(TData.Conn);      시도하다        TData.Qry.Connection := TData.Conn;        TData.Qry.SQL.Text : 'SELECT * FROM NurseLogin WHERE Username=:uname AND Password=:pword AND PinCode=:pin;'을 의미합니다.        TData.Qry.Params.ParamByName('uname').AsString := 사용자 이름 입력. 텍스트;       TData.Qry.Params.ParamByName('pword').AsString: PasswordInput인지 확인하려면 같음. 텍스트;       TData.Qry.Params.ParamByName('핀').AsString := PincodeInput. 텍스트;       TData.Qry.Active := 참;        TData.Qry.RecordCount = 0이면 ShowMessage(인식 대신 '세부 정보'), 그렇지 않으면 TData.Qry.RecordCount = 하나만 있으면             시작할 때               if TData.Qry.FieldByName('IsActive').AsBoolean then //사용자가 활성을 선택할 경우               시작하다                 시도하다                   // 경로에 연결합니다.                   companyPath := TData.Qry.FieldByName('회사명').AsString;                   TData.Conn.Params.Database := + 'dpulsedb' companyPath + 'Pulse.mdb';                   TData.Conn.Connected: True를 의미합니다.                   ShowMessage('연결됨' + 벤처 경로);                 마지막으로                 끝;               끝;             끝;      마지막으로      끝;    끝;  마지막으로  끝;끝;

거래 오류 시 액세스 위반을 수정하려면 어떻게 선택합니까?

컴퓨터에서 맬웨어를 검사합니다.제외 목록에 프로그램을 추가합니다.사용자 계정 제어를 제한하는 것을 고려하십시오.유틸리티가 읽기 전용 모드가 아닌지 확인하십시오.가족 RAM이 손상되었는지 확인하십시오.하드웨어 문제를 해결하십시오.

오늘 최고의 Windows 복구 도구를 받으세요. Reimage은 오류를 정리 및 복구하고 데이터 손실 및 하드웨어 오류로부터 보호합니다.

Access Violation At Address No Delphi 7
Violacao De Acesso No Endereco No Delphi 7
Toegangsschending Op Adres No Delphi 7
Atkomstovertradelse Pa Adress Nr Delphi 7
Violation D Acces A L Adresse No Delphi 7
Naruszenie Dostepu Pod Adresem Bez Delphi 7
Narushenie Prav Dostupa Po Adresu No Delphi 7
Violazione Di Accesso All Indirizzo N Delphi 7
Violacion De Acceso En La Direccion No Delphi 7
Zugriffsverletzung Bei Adresse Nr Delphi 7

Previous post Hur Det Hjälper Till Att Fixa Rar Reparationsverktyg V.4.0 Portable
Next post Dépannage Et Résolution Des Problèmes D’écriture De Données Dans Des Servlets Avec Jquery